What is Drop Shipping?

Drop shipping is a e-commerce business model where you sell products online for online earnings without actually holding any inventory. When a customer places an order, you purchase the product from a supplier who then ships it directly to the customer. This means that you don’t have to worry about storing, packing, or shipping the products yourself.

How Does Drop Shipping Work?

Starting an online store can be a lucrative business venture, but it requires careful planning and execution. Here are six steps to help you get started:

Step 1: Choose a Niche

The first step to starting an online store is to choose a niche that you are passionate about and can successfully sell products in. This could be anything from electronics to pet supplies. When choosing a niche, consider your interests, expertise, and target audience.

Step 2: Find a Supplier

Once you have identified your niche, you’ll need to find a reliable supplier who can provide the products you want to sell at a reasonable price. Research different suppliers and compare their prices and product quality before making a decision.

Step 3: Set up an Online Store

You can set up an online store using popular e-commerce platforms like Shopify, WooCommerce, or BigCommerce. These platforms make it easy to create a professional-looking online store without needing any coding experience.

Step 4: List Your Products

Once your online store is set up, you can start listing your products. Write compelling product descriptions, upload high-quality photos, and set competitive prices. Optimize your product listings for search engines to increase your chances of being found by potential customers.

Step 5: Start Promoting Your Store

With your products listed, it’s time to start promoting your online store and driving traffic to your website. Use social media, email marketing, and other digital marketing tactics to reach your target audience. Collaborate with influencers or run ads to increase visibility.

Step 6: Fulfill Orders

When a customer places an order, purchase the product from your supplier and have it shipped directly to the customer. Make sure to provide excellent customer service and communicate with your customers throughout the fulfillment process.

Pros and Cons of Drop Shipping

Pros:

  • Low start-up costs: You don’t need to invest a lot of money to start a drop shipping e-commerce business.
  • Low overhead costs: You don’t need to worry about renting a physical store or holding inventory.
  • Easy to get started: Setting up an online store is easy and can be done in a matter of hours.
  • Wide selection of products: You can sell a wide range of products without having to store them yourself.

Cons:

  • Low profit margins: Since you are not buying products in bulk, you may not get the best wholesale price.
  • No control over inventory: You are at the mercy of your suppliers, and if they run out of stock, you may have to refund orders.
  • Shipping times: Shipping times can be longer since the products are coming from a supplier.

Tips for Success in Drop Shipping

  • Choose the right niche: Choose a niche that you are passionate about and that has a good profit margin.
  • Find reliable suppliers: Look for suppliers who have a good reputation and can provide high-quality products.
  • Focus on customer service: Providing excellent customer service is key to building a successful drop shipping ecommerce business.
  • Stay organized: Keep track of your orders, shipments, and returns to ensure that your ecommerce business runs smoothly.
  • Stay up-to-date with trends: Keep an eye on trends and adapt your product offerings accordingly.

FAQs:

Q: Can I start a drop shipping e-commerce business with no money?

A: While it is possible to start a drop shipping e-commerce business with no money, you will need some capital to invest in marketing and advertising to get your e-commerce business off the ground.

Q: Can I sell products from any country as a drop shipper?

A: Yes, you can sell products from any country as a drop shipper, but it’s important to be aware of any import laws and regulations in your country.

Q: How do I handle returns and refunds?

A: You will need to work with your supplier to handle returns and refunds. Make sure to have a clear return policy in place and communicate it to your customers.
